Template-protected edit request on 9 January 2021[edit]

Help section appears to be "broken" (but still technically functional), which results in the same "error" cascaded to other templates. Specifically, the first parameter in the provided template is left blank, instead of being removed altogether if not supplied. This may not have been previously visible, as {{Tlx}} was recently updated; please see Special:PageHistory/Template:Template link expanded.

Here is the problematic part:

<small>Usage: {{tlx|{{{template<noinclude>|di-foo</noinclude>}}}|{{#if:{{{source|}}}|source={{{source}}}}} |date={{#time:j ...

Based on my testing, this appears to work (diff on sandbox):

<small>Usage: {{tlx|{{{template<noinclude>|di-foo</noinclude>}}}|{{#if:{{{source|}}}|source={{{source}}}{{!}}}}date={{#time:j ...

Please double-check though for possible errors before actually implementing the correction. Thanks. Ntx61 (talk) 16:48, 9 January 2021 (UTC)[reply]
